The S&P/ASX 200 fell 0.4% to around 8,920 on early Wednesday trade, marking its third consecutive session of losses, driven by declines from tech and gold stocks. A weak lead on Wall Street also dragged the index, as investors weighed the prolonged US government shutdown and renewed doubts over the durability of the AI-driven rally. Meanwhile, markets assessed the World Bank’s decision to raise its growth forecast for parts of East Asia and the Pacific, after a summer marked by US tariff-related uncertainty that weighed on global sentiment. On the corporate front, tech shares dropped 1.5% to a one-month low, tracking their US peers lower. The sub-index extended losses for a third straight session, with sector constituents Life360 Inc falling 4.4% and WiseTech Global slipping 1%. Additionally, gold miners lagged, down 2.1%, as investors seem to take profits. Sector leaders Newmont and Northern Star slid 1.1% and 1.7%, respectively. Financials also fell, led by top lender NAB (-0.5%).
